Jammu, Apr 10 (UNI)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ister Ghulam Nabi Azad has greeted the people on the twin occasion of Id-e-Milad-un-Nabi and Mahavir Jayanti.

In a message issued here today the Chief Minister highlighted the great principles and teachings of Prophet Mohammad, which taught mankind to seek purity of heart and mind and live a life dedicated to the blessings of Almighty Allah.

He said, ''This holy day reminds as of the deepest love exhibited by great Prophet for mankind. He said as true believers we have to follow footprints of the apostle of God and strive for removing misery disease and poverty from the society.'' In another message, the Chief Minister mentioned the teachings of Lord Mahavira, based on equality, social justice, high ethics and patience, which have withstood the test of time. Mr Azad prayed for peace and prosperity of the people of the state on the occasion.
